Adult, Five Juveniles Charged With Burglary

(Batesville, Ind.) - Six people – five of them juveniles – are being charged with a home burglary in Batesville.

 

The Batesville Herald Tribune reports a Batesville Police Department report shows the break-in happened in December 2010 at a home on Arlington Drive. The report was filed in August.

 

Jesus Gil, 18, of Batesville, was arrested for Burglary on November 17. Five local male juveniles ages 16 through 17 are also facing Burglary and Theft charges.

 

The juveniles may be waived to adult court.
